Title: The Innovative Mind of Shih-Yu Tseng
Introduction
Shih-Yu Tseng is a notable inventor based in Hsinchu, Taiwan. He has made significant contributions to the field of semiconductor technology, boasting a total of three patents to his name. His work showcases innovative solutions aimed at addressing critical challenges in technology and environmental concerns.
Latest Patents
Among his latest inventions, Tseng has developed an "Air Curtain for Defect Reduction." This innovative air curtain device is designed to minimize defects on semiconductor wafers by implementing it along tracks equipped with robotic wafer transport systems. The air curtain prevents contaminants, such as volatile organic solvent mist, from reaching wafer surfaces, thereby enhancing the integrity of semiconductor processing.
Another significant patent of Tseng's is the "Heavy Metal Detecting Device and the Fabricating Method Thereof." This invention introduces a heavy metal detecting device comprising a substrate and a nano-metal-particle array. The fabrication method emphasizes simplicity and rapidity, contrasting with prior art methods, facilitating efficient detection of heavy metals. The steps outlined for this device involve thorough processes of cleaning, soaking, and synthesizing, ensuring high efficacy in detecting heavy metal contaminants.
Career Highlights
Shih-Yu Tseng has had a robust career, working at notable institutions such as National Tsing Hua University and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company Ltd. His affiliation with these esteemed organizations has enabled him to utilize his expertise to contribute to significant advancements in semiconductor technology.
